The real estate market in Bellegarde

Real Estate Market Projection in Bellegarde

The real estate market in Bellegarde is a dynamic market with a number of buyers 7.0% higher than the number of properties for sale.

Selling prices in Bellegarde should therefore be increasing and the time on market decreasing.

In Bellegarde, an apartment sells for €2,449/m² on average and a house for €2,744/m² in 2025. Over five years, prices moved by +19.3% for apartments and +9.8% for houses.

Average price per m² in Bellegarde by year, apartments and houses
YearApartmentsHouses
2014€1,755/m²€1,993/m²
2015€1,856/m²€2,032/m²
2016€1,723/m²€2,120/m²
2017€1,723/m²€2,202/m²
2018€1,781/m²€2,249/m²
2019€1,861/m²€2,356/m²
2020€2,053/m²€2,498/m²
2021€2,323/m²€2,629/m²
2022€2,440/m²€2,731/m²
2023€2,427/m²€2,815/m²
2024€2,480/m²€2,773/m²
2025€2,449/m²€2,744/m²

The average rent of an apartment in Bellegarde is 11.5 €/m² per month, a gross yield of 5.6% at the average purchase price.

The housing stock in Bellegarde

2,969 dwellings · 2.26 people per dwelling

Housing size

Tenants and owners

Bellegarde has 2,969 dwellings, 19.1% of them apartments. Studios and two-room flats make up 10.1% of the stock, and 30.7% of households rent their main home.

About 9 dwellings rated F or G, banned from renting since 2025 for G.
4.4%
affected by the rental ban (E to G)
Timeline: G in 2025, F in 2028, E in 2034. A lever for negotiation and value after renovation.

4.4% of dwellings are rated E, F or G and affected by the progressive rental ban, including 0.9% rated F or G.

Bellegarde has 7,740 inhabitants, a median age of 39 and a density of 171 inhabitants per km².

The median annual household income is €28,777, with an unemployment rate of 14.8%.
